On 14 Jan 2005 Aaron (aamehl(_at_)pop(_dot_)actcom(_dot_)net(_dot_)il) wrote:
A message that you sent could not be delivered to one or more of its
recipients. This is a permanent error. The following address(es) failed:

  pipe to |IFS=' ' && exec /usr/bin/procmail -f- || exit 75 #kodiak
    generated by aamehl@(none)
    "IFS='" command not found for address_pipe transport

Try removing your .forward file, e.g., by running:

 mv -i ~/.forward ~/.forward.OFF

Nowadays it is rare to need it to invoke procmail. If find that you do need a .forward, try something simple like:

 "|/usr/bin/procmail"

I have details in my Procmail Quick Start in this section:

 <http://www.ii.com/internet/robots/procmail/qs/#forward>
